| Ethyne-1,2-diyldiboronic acid dipinacol ester Basic information |
| Product Name: | Ethyne-1,2-diyldiboronic acid dipinacol ester | | Synonyms: | 1,2-Bis(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)ethyne;Acetylene-1,2-diyl bis(boronic acid pinacol ester);Ethyne-1,2-diyl bis(boronic acid pinacol ester);Ethyne-1,2-diyldiboronic acid dipinacol ester;1,2-bis(4',4',5',5'-tetramethyl[1',3',2']dioxaborolan-2'-yl)acetylene;1,2-Ethynediboronic acid Bis(pinacol) Ester;1,3,2-Dioxaborolane, 2,2'-(1,2-ethynediyl)bis[4,4,5,5-tetramethyl- | | CAS: | 1010840-17-1 | | MF: | C14H24B2O4 | | MW: | 277.96 | | EINECS: | | Product Categories: | | Mol File: | 1010840-17-1.mol |
| Ethyne-1,2-diyldiboronic acid dipinacol ester Chemical Properties |
| Melting point | 269°C | | Boiling point | 257.5±23.0 °C(Predicted) | | density | 1.00±0.1 g/cm3(Predicted) | | storage temp. | 2-8°C | | form | powder to crystal | | color | White to Almost white |

| Ethyne-1,2-diyldiboronic acid dipinacol ester Usage And Synthesis |
| Uses | Reactant for the preparation of:- Poly(p-phenyleneethynylene)s (PPEs), which are used in constructing organic light-emitting diodes (OLEDs), field-effect transistors (FETs) and several other materials used in electronic devices
